      I usually have a lot of files open at a time, so finding them are a pain. Often times, I’ll just go back to the source, and re-click on the file to open it in Notepad++.

      What I’d like to do, is move my latest opened files (tabs) to the right. So I know where my latest stuff is. I could probably set a macro or something, but to do that, is there a keyboard shortcut to move the current tab left or right (or even all the way to the right)?

        assign a shortcut to ‘Move to other view’ and press it twice.

          You could also turn off tabs and try the Window Manager plug-in which keeps the open files in a list that you can sort by filename, extension, or full path. You just click on a file to make it the current one.

          If you know which file you want to work on next by name, it works pretty well.
